There have been 178,162 residential properties sold in the North Carolina real estate market over the past 12 months. As of October 2025, the median home price in NC on single-family homes is $360,000. The median single-family home value for properties over the last 12 months is $336,448. Currently, the State of North Carolina has 1,073 properties in foreclosure and 150 REOs (real estate bank owned).

North Carolina Foreclosure Activity

There were a total of 1,073 North Carolina properties with a foreclosure filing in September 2025. Lenders started the foreclosure process on 665 North Carolina properties and repossessed 150 North Carolina properties through completed foreclosures (REOs) in September 2025.
